BT(Back-thinned)-CCD Cooled Digital Camera


ORCA II-BT-1024G


BT(Back-thinned)-CCD Cooled Digital Camera

The ORCA II-BT-1024G features the well known Marconi CCD47-10 chip packaged in a proprietary permanently sealed vacuum chamber evacuated to 10-7 Torr. This very high resolution, back thinned, back illuminated, million pixel CCD offers very high quantum efficiency over the spectrum from 350 nm to 900 nm. With a large full well capacity, low read noise and MPP (Multi-Pinned Phase) technology in the drive circuits to reduce dark current, this camera will produce rapid exposures and high dynamic range images. Dual mode digitization offers a software selectable choice of speed or very low noise readout methods with 12 bit to 16 bit precision. Special analog contrast enhancement circuits increase versatility for even the most difficult imaging conditions.

FEATURES
・  High  resolution  format
・  High  quantum  efficiency  from  UV  to  NIR
・  Compatible  with  IIDC  1394-based  digital  camera  specifications
・  Full  remote  controle  from  PC  via  IEEE  1394  Bus
APPLICATIONS
・  Luminescence  and  Fluorescence
・  High  resolution  video  microscopy
・  Semiconductor  imaging
・  X-ray  applications
・  Neutron  radiography
・  Scintillator  readout
